I've been feeling bub kicking for the past 2 weeks but was wondering when my DP will be able to feel it from the outside? He's desperate to be able to feel the kicks too.
My best advice is to spoon him with your belly against his back when you get into bed at night ... with bubba kicking at his tender lower-back .. he might feel it.
And give it some more time .. the bigger you get, the bigger bubba gets, the stronger bubba gets, the harder he kicks, the more likely DH will feel it.
It shouldn't be too much longer before DH can feel the kicks. I think it was probably about 3-4 weeks after I started feeling them regularly when DH started feeling them. But it is mostly a matter of luck - having DH around when bub is active and having the time to stop and rest with a hand on your belly to see what happens.
